Here is your free essay on Food Chains. Article Shared By. ADVERTISEMENTS: Anything which we eat to live is called food. Food contains energy. The food (or energy) can be transferred from one organism to the other through food chains. The starting point of a food chain is a category of organisms called producers. Producers are, in fact, plants.

Food, Inc., an American documentary film, examines the industrial production of meat, grains, and vegetables.The film concludes by claiming the entirety of our food industry is inhumane, and economically and environmentally unsustainable. The film continues to examine today’s industry by exploring the economic and legal powers large food companies have.
